There are many opportunities in the game to earn free increases in one or more skill levels, most often as a reward for completing a favor for an NPC. The following is a list of rewards that directly increase skill level(s). The increase is similar to training the skill, and counts towards leveling as normal. The skill boost does not set the skill's progress bar to zero (for example, if you have already spent some time training the skill and the skill is just about to increase, it will still be just as close to increasing again after the free skill boost, or higher if you have an experience bonus from a Standing Stone or resting active). The bonus is not available if your skill level is already at 100.

Fortify Skill effects applied by Alchemy, Enchanting, or Magicka do not affect these skill boosts, as they are temporary effects.

Notes[edit]

Only one radiant quest of a similar type can be assigned at any given time. You must clear the radiant quest from your miscellaneous quests in order to be eligible to receive another of the same type.
When reading the Oghma Infinium, you may only choose one set of skill boosts: combat, magic, or stealth. For the other two skill groups, the bonus becomes unavailable.

Free Training[edit]

Trainers who are also followers can train you for "free".¥ They will still charge you, but leave profit from training in their inventory. Simply request to see their inventory while they are an active follower, and take your gold back from any training sessions. This can be done with the following NPCs:
